Understanding the Core Functions of an Apparel Production Manager
The role of an Apparel Production Manager Roles And Responsibilities PDF is pivotal in aligning design, sourcing, manufacturing, and quality control into a cohesive workflow. These professionals bridge creative vision with industrial execution, managing teams and processes that transform raw materials into finished garments ready for market. Their responsibilities span planning, monitoring, and optimizing every stage of production to meet tight deadlines without compromising quality. At the heart of this role lies meticulous scheduling. The Apparel Production Manager Roles And Responsibilities PDF emphasizes creating detailed timelines that synchronize design development with material procurement and factory output. This ensures production bottlenecks are minimized, allowing for consistent throughput even under fluctuating demand or supply chain pressures. By forecasting capacity needs and adjusting workflows proactively, managers maintain operational fluidity and cost efficiency. Supervising Cross-Functional Teams A key duty involves leading multidisciplinary teams—designers, pattern makers, machinists, quality inspectors, and logistics coordinators. The Apparel Production Manager Roles And Responsibilities PDF stresses fostering collaboration through clear communication channels and performance metrics. Managers not only delegate tasks but also mentor team members, driving continuous improvement through feedback loops and training initiatives. This leadership nurtures a culture where accountability and innovation coexist, directly enhancing product quality and delivery speed. Quality assurance remains non-negotiable in this role. Overseeing inspection protocols ensures compliance with brand standards and regulatory requirements. Managers implement rigorous testing procedures at multiple stages—from fabric verification to final garment checks—to prevent defects before products reach retailers or consumers. Detailed documentation within the PDF guide supports traceability and facilitates rapid issue resolution when inconsistencies arise. Efficiency optimization is another critical focus area detailed in the Apparel Production Manager Roles And Responsibilities PDF. Leveraging data analytics tools helps identify process inefficiencies such as idle time or material waste. By introducing lean manufacturing principles—like Just-In-Time inventory management or continuous flow layouts—managers significantly reduce overheads while sustaining high output levels even during seasonal peaks or unexpected disruptions. Supply chain coordination is equally vital; these professionals act as central nodes connecting suppliers, manufacturers, distributors, and retailers. They negotiate contracts, monitor supplier performance, mitigate risks like delays or shortages, and ensure ethical sourcing practices align with corporate values—all essential for maintaining brand reputation in global markets governed by strict sustainability standards today.
